FWBC publishes operational performance data
To demonstrate a commitment to transparency and openness, Fair Work Building & Construction (FWBC) will publish its Dashboard report online, following a two-month internal trial.
Available on the Accountability and Reporting page of FWBC’s website, the Dashboard report will provide data on the agency’s operational performance against its key performance indicators and targets.
“This information helps to track how we are progressing against our Statement of Strategic Intent goals,” said FWBC Chief Executive Leigh Johns. “It will now be readily available to the public, building industry participants and the media so they can see exactly how the agency is tracking.”
Information covered by the Dashboard report includes the percentage of investigations finalised within 90 days, the average age of matters filed in court and the percentage of enquiries responded to within one working day.
“FWBC is committed to open and transparent operations,” Johns said. “Making the Dashboard report available to citizens is an important part of this and is in line with the Office of the Australian Information Commissioner’s principles on open public sector information.”
